Title: Cigar End Rot Management for Banana: Effective Methods to Combat this Fungal Disease

Introduction:

Bananas are one of the most widely cultivated and consumed fruits worldwide, providing essential nutrients and economic resources to many regions. However, banana plants are susceptible to various diseases, including cigar end rot. This fungal infection can cause significant damage to both the fruit and the plant if not addressed promptly. In this article, we will discuss effective management strategies to combat cigar end rot in banana plants.

Understanding cigar end rot:

Cigar end rot (also known as Fusarium rot) is caused by the fungus Fusarium semitectum. This disease primarily affects the fruit, causing rotting at the distal or blossom end. Initially, small brown or black spots appear on the fruit, developing into larger, sunken areas with a cigar-like shape. As the rot progresses, it can spread to the entire fruit and eventually infect the plant.

Management strategies:

1. Maintain optimal plant health:
– Ensure proper soil drainage to avoid waterlogging, which can promote fungal growth.
– Implement good cultural practices, such as regular fertilization and water management, to maintain plant vigor and resistance.

2. Promptly remove infected fruit:
– Inspect banana bunches frequently, identifying and removing any fruit showing signs of cigar end rot.
– Dispose of infected fruit away from the plantation, ensuring they don’t act as a source of reinfection.

3. Improve air circulation:
– Thinning of the canopy by removing excessive sucker shoots can enhance air movement within the plantation.
– Better airflow can reduce humidity levels, creating an unfavorable environment for fungal growth.

4. Fungicide application:
– In severe cases, applying appropriate fungicides can help control cigar end rot. Consult with agricultural experts or local extension services to identify and use suitable fungicides.
– Follow all instructions provided on the fungicide label and adhere to recommended safety practices.

5. Soil and crop rotation:
– Implementing crop rotation practices can break the disease cycle and reduce the fungal load in the soil.
– Choose alternative non-host crops during crop rotation to limit the occurrence of cigar end rot.

6. Biocontrol agents:
– Explore the utilization of biological control agents to manage cigar end rot effectively.
– Certain beneficial microorganisms can suppress fungal growth and protect bananas from disease. Consult agricultural experts for advice on suitable biocontrol options.
